Topic: need to print the report name only once for report
Replies: 2
Views: 3771

Hi Radha, You can define the name and parameters either on the report Header Section so that it will be visible only on the report header, or if you want to place them in the Main Section then place these fields in a fixed frame and then set the frame property to display on first page. Topic: Balances table
Replies: 1
Views: 3244

Dear Imran, you can get your required data from AR_PAYMENT_SCHEDULES_ALL for Receivables and AP_PAYMENT_SCHEDULES_ALL for payables, but it does not store the data month wise, you will need to query it month wise on the basis of TRX_DATE and amount can be picked from AMOUNT_DUE_REMAINING. Topic: how to print user id in customized report
Replies: 4
Views: 4828

Hi,
You can pass the USERID or USERNAME from the application by a parameter.
Add a parameter , set default type as profile and default value as USERNAME or whatever profile value you need to pass.

Topic: change or build new sql-statement in BI-Publisher
Replies: 4
Views: 4047

Hi,
you can build a new report from report builder, register it in the application and set the output to xml then attach a template using XML Publisher Responsibilty.
You can also write a procedure that generates an XML output and use the XML data in your template.
